Heads up: the Glimmerpane snapshot suite is flaking again on the nightly run. The diffs are all one-pixel shifts in the Tooltip and Badge components, which usually means the headless renderer on the Quartzline runners picked up a font cache update. Don't rubber-stamp the snapshots — re-run the job once first; if the diffs persist, regenerate locally with the pinned renderer image and compare. Check the artifact bundle before approving anything. The failing run's trace token is below.

pipeline stamp: htk3_a71

Hey Dario — quick note before your shift. The prototype workshop on level 2 at Quillhaven is mid-build for the Sparrowjig demo, so please don't move anything on the benches, even the mess. Tamsin's team left the 3D printers running; just glance at them on your rounds. If you need to get in for the safety check, use the code below.

badge for fafop-fajof: bdg-Z-47

## Retrying Failed Exports — Vantryx Pipeline

Failed exports land in the `export_dlq` table. Check the failure reason first; most are transient storage timeouts.

To retry:
1. Confirm the batch isn't still locked (`status = RUNNING` older than 2h means stale).
2. Flip status to `PENDING`.
3. The scheduler picks it up within 5 minutes.

Never retry batches flagged `SCHEMA_MISMATCH` — escalate to the Korvale data team instead.

To inspect the queue directly, connect to the exports database using the connection string below.

primary connection of yagep-kahip = redis://giliel_svc:zYiKsLL2PLpfPL@db-348f.xolmarsys.corp:5432/fenwyn

Subject: Heads-up on warranty costs — Glentide range

Team,

Quick note before Thursday's call: warranty claims on the Glentide pumps ran well over provision this quarter, mostly seal failures from one production run. Service is handling replacements, and Nadia's group is chasing the supplier for recovery. Please flag any unusual claim patterns at your branches this week. How this affects next year's plans is covered in the confidential note below.

management briefing: The renewal with Zoraelax Group closes at $10 million a year, 15 percent below the last contract. Project Ralael slips by six weeks because of the audit delay.